AN IVORY NETSUKE
edo period (early 19th century), signed yoshimasa
Carved as the figure of Gama sennin reclining and biting into a peach as his frog companion crawls over his side, the figure's robes decorated with an incised cloud pattern, the frog highly polished and with large eyes of inlaid ebony, himotoshi formed of folds in the figure's robes on the base, signed in a rectangular cartouche on the reverse--2 5/8 in. (6.5cm.) high
